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Oranges with Peel vs Japanese Persimmons:
- 5 ounces of Oranges with Peel have 3.3 times more Vitamin B1, 2.5 times more Vitamin B2, 5 times more Vitamin B3, 3.8 times more Vitamin B9 and 9.5 times more Vitamin C than Japanese Persimmons.
- While 5 oz of Raw Japanese Persimmons contain 6.2 times more Vitamin A than Raw Oranges with Peel .
- Both Oranges with Peel and Japanese Persimmons provide similar amounts of Vitamin B6 per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Oranges with Peel have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A
- 5 ounces of Japanese Persimmons have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B2 and Vitamin B3
- Both Raw Oranges with Peel as well as Raw Japanese Persimmons have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 in five ounces.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Oranges with Peel vs Japanese Persimmons:
- 5 ounces of Oranges with Peel have 8.8 times more Calcium, 5.3 times more Iron, 1.6 times more Magnesium, 1.3 times more Phosphorus and 1.2 times more Potassium than Japanese Persimmons.
- While 5 oz of Raw Japanese Persimmons contain 2 times more Copper than Raw Oranges with Peel .
- Both Oranges with Peel and Japanese Persimmons contain similar levels of Water per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Japanese Persimmons l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Iron
- Both Raw Oranges with Peel as well as Raw Japanese Persimmons lack sufficient amounts of Selenium and Zinc in five 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Oranges with Peel have 1.3 times more Fiber and 2.2 times more Protein than Japanese Persimmons.
- Both Oranges with Peel and Japanese Persimmons offer comparable quantities of Energy and Carbohydrate per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Japanese Persimmons provide inadequate amounts of Protein
- Both Raw Oranges with Peel as well as Raw Japanese Persimmons prov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 and Omega 6 in five ounces.
